What is the focal point in art, therefore? The focal area is considered the predominant place where the eye enjoys seeing: The most value contrast (dark against light) Color contrast (chroma versus grayness, red against gray) Hard edges (agrees with the fovea of the eye) Detail (complexity of shape) Warm colors (yellows and reds attract the eye)

The focal point of a painting is an area of emphasis that demands the most attention and to which the viewer's eye is drawn, pulling it into the painting. It is like the bullseye on a target, although not as overt. It is how the artist draws attention to the particular content of the painting and is often the most important element of the painting.

A Focal Point is an area in a painting or drawing that immediately draws the viewer's attention and guides them around the composition. Artists use this technique to lead a person's gaze through an artwork, much like how a tour guide might lead tourists throughout a city.

Focal Point | John Lovett Artist Focal Points Make them work for you Somewhere in every painting there is a point of maximum tonal contrast. This point shouldn't occur by accident, but should be carefully placed to work as a focal point for the painting.
